Minister of State for External Affairs Bianca Odumegwu-Ojukwu meets with the Ghana President

Minister of state for External Affairs Iyom Bianca Odumegwu-Ojukwu meets with the Ghana President John Dramani to diffuse escalating tension in Nigeria/Ghana relations
Iyom Bianca Odumegwu-Ojukwu wrote…
It was an engaging session with the President of Ghana H.E John Dramani Mahama to convey the concerns of the President of the Federal Republic of Nigeria H E Bola Ahmed Tinubu, and the people of Nigeria over the protests against Nigerian nationals in Ghana .
The Ghanaian President has committed to promoting peace, as had hitherto been the situation between Ghanaian citizens and the Nigerian community and to ensure that both citizens and non-citizens, including their properties and assets are safe and secure.
He also called for all residents to adhere to the laws of the country and avoid inflammatory rhetoric capable of creating tensions and fanning embers of violence, reiterating that Nigeria and Ghana have a shared history, and are strategic pillars of ECOWAS, the Economic Community of West Africa States.
‘Convey to my brother, President Bola Ahmed Tinubu, and people of the Federal Republic of Nigeria that Ghanaians are peace loving and hospitable people. We share a historic bond with Nigeria. We have enjoyed excellent bilateral relations through the years. Our Government is committed to protecting the lives and properties of all who reside in our country, and we continue to urge all residents to be law abiding’.
